Output 257107355a5fa74d70f6f4986c1b2a8fc7945c017a9cf5320dc175059ffd434a:1

value
997828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08039b898ae591809a6901ab0a1efae39ff13df OP_EQUAL
address
3LhU5hw2g4qdQ39zu6vnUzWHqG39fTspoC
transaction
257107355a5fa74d70f6f4986c1b2a8fc7945c017a9cf5320dc175059ffd434a
spent
true